About us

Capital Construction was founded in 2005. We are an award-winning exterior contracting specialist. We specialize in roofing, siding, windows, and doors, and pride ourselves on fantastic customer service and top-notch craftsmanship. We hold numerous certifications in the industry, and we are proud to work with the best products from leading manufacturers. No matter what home improvement needs you have, Capital is here to provide you with quality solutions. Our mission is simple: to improve the lives of our customers by providing the highest quality building materials installed by highly skilled, professionally trained craftspersons with the highest level of customer service.

Services we offer

All Exterior Needs: (Shingle, Rubber, Slate & Copper Roofing, James Hardie Siding & Cedar Siding, Masonry, Framing, Deck Builds, Carpentry, Skylights & Roof Hatches, Custom Window & Door install, Interior & Exterior Painting, and Roof Snow Removal - (no ice) Large custom gut / remodels upon request. Capital Construction is an Elite preferred James Hardie Install Contractor, Master Elite Certified GAF roofing contractor,3 Star Velux Installer & a Licensed Carlisle Epdm (Rubber roofing) applicator
